There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Wells is 19.1% cheaper than South Barre. With a cost index of 88 vs 105,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Wells to South Barre should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.

On the housing front, median rent in South Barre is $1,631/month compared to $1,208/month in Wells — a 35%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Wells is more affordable at $198,400 median vs $246,900.

Median household income in South Barre is $78,162 compared to $73,750 in Wells (+6%). South Barre does offer higher incomes, but the salary premium barely offsets the higher cost of living, leaving residents with a tighter budget. Looking at affordability, residents of South Barre spend roughly 25% of their income on rent, more than the 19.7% in Wells.
